175B.065 Project revenue bonds not a debt or pledge of faith and credit of the Commonwealth or its subdivisions -- Statement on face of bonds. (1) (2) Project revenue bonds issued by an authority under this chapter shall not constitute a debt of the Commonwealth or any of its political subdivisions, or a pledge of the faith and credit of the Commonwealth or any of its political subdivisions. Project revenue bonds issued pursuant to this chapter, shall be payable solely from the funds provided for in this chapter including but not limited to the funds described in KRS 175B.025(1)(c). Project revenue bonds shall contain on their face a statement to the effect that neither the Commonwealth nor the issuing authority shall be obligated to pay the bonds or the interest thereon, except from any and all revenues associated with the project for which they are issued, and that neither the faith and credit nor the taxing power of the Commonwealth is pledged to the payment of the principal of or the interest on these project revenue bonds. Effective: June 26, 2009 History: Created 2009 (1st Extra. Sess.) Ky. Acts ch. 1, sec. 87, effective June 26, 2009.
